15th century building built in masonry, with ashlars reinforcing angles and corners, which reserves a good masonry factory for the main façade, using lighter granite and thus creating a chromatic contrast with the rest. At the ends, twin turrets finished off with pyramidal spiers and balls, with three bodies separated by imposts and the blind panels highlighted with a recess giving triangular, square and curved shapes.

Classic structure of a typical town hall building, with a double arcade marking the two heights. The lower one, with an access gate and continuous bench protected from the weather to facilitate the meeting of the inhabitants and the upper one, with government and decision functions.
